手游

如何制作手机单机游戏

时间:2024-03-08 15:44:02128 人浏览举报

手机单机游戏是一种不需要网络连接的游戏,可以随时随地在手机上进行娱乐。制作手机单机游戏需要一些专业技术和知识。下面是关于如何制作手机单机游戏的一些常见问题和答案。

制作手机单机游戏需要哪些技术和知识

制作手机单机游戏需要掌握编程语言、游戏设计和图形处理等方面的技术和知识。常用的编程语言有C++、Java等,游戏设计可以使用Unity、Cocos2d等游戏引擎,图形处理可以通过OpenGL、DirectX等工具来实现。

如何选择适合的游戏引擎

选择适合的游戏引擎需要考虑自己的技术水平和项目需求。Unity是一款功能强大且易于上手的游戏引擎,适合初学者和小型项目。Cocos2d则更适合有一定编程基础的开发者,可以制作出更为复杂的游戏。其他的游戏引擎还有Unreal Engine、Godot等,可以根据项目需求选择合适的引擎。

游戏的开发周期是多久

游戏的开发周期因项目规模和团队规模而有所不同。对于小型项目和独立开发者来说,单机游戏的开发周期可能在几个月到一年之间。而对于大型团队和复杂项目来说,可能需要更长的时间来完成开发。

游戏的测试和发布流程是怎样的

在游戏开发完成后,需要进行测试和优化。测试可以使用模拟器或真机进行,检查游戏的功能和性能。优化则需要对游戏的代码和资源进行调整,以提高游戏的运行效果和用户体验。完成测试和优化后,可以将游戏发布到应用商店或其他渠道,供用户下载和玩耍。

如何获得游戏的收益

游戏的收益主要来自于广告和应用内购买。可以通过在游戏中嵌入广告来获取广告费用,也可以设置虚拟物品或游戏币的购买选项,通过应用内购买来获得收益。还可以考虑合作推广或赞助等方式来增加游戏的收益。

经过了解,我们可以了解到制作手机单机游戏需要掌握编程语言、游戏设计和图形处理等技术和知识。选择适合的游戏引擎,考虑项目需求和个人技术水平。游戏开发周期根据项目规模和团队规模而定,需进行测试和优化后进行发布。游戏的收益可以通过广告和应用内购买等途径获得。希望这些信息对于想要制作手机单机游戏的人们有所帮助。

感谢你浏览了全部内容~